Sparse classifiers for Automated HeartWall Motion Abnormality Detection

Glenn Fung; Maleeha Qazi; Sriram Krishnan; Jinbo Bi; Bharat Rao; Alan S. Katz

Coronary Heart Disease is the single leading cause of death world-wide, with lack of early diagnosis being a key contributory factor. This disease can be diagnosed by measuring and scoring regional motion of the heart wall in echocardiography images of the left ventricle (LV) of the heart. We describe a completely automated and robust technique that detects diseased hearts based on automatic detection and tracking of the endocardium and epicardium of the LV. We describe a novel feature selection technique based on mathematical programming that results in a robust hyperplane-based classifier. The classifier depends only on a small subset of numerical feature extracted from dualcontours tracked through time. We verify the robustness of our system on echocardiograms collected in routine clinical practice at one hospital, both with the standard crossvalidation analysis, and then on a held-out set of completely unseen echocardiography images.

An Insurance Recommendation System Using Bayesian Networks

Maleeha Qazi; Glenn Fung; Katie J. Meissner; Eduardo R. Fontes

In this paper we describe a deployed recommender system to predict insurance products for new and existing customers. Our goal is to give our customers personalized recommendations based on what other similar people with similar portfolios have, in order to make sure they were adequately covered for their needs. Our system uses customer characteristics in addition to customer portfolio data. Since the number of possible recommendable products is relatively small, compared to other recommender domains, and missing data is relatively frequent, we chose to use Bayesian Networks for modeling our system. Experimental results show advantages of using probabilistic graphical models over the widely used low-rank matrix factorization model for the insurance domain.
